Self-reacting solids are described as?

Explanation:
Self-reacting solids are materials that can undergo a chemical reaction on their own, driven by internal heat, even without an external oxidizer like air. They are thermally unstable and may decompose in a strongly exothermic way, and this decomposition can proceed without participation of oxygen. So describing them as solids that do not react at all would miss their defining hazard—the potential for self-sustained, energetic reaction. The other ideas, such as needing oxygen to ignite or reacting only with water, don’t capture the danger profile of self-reacting solids, which is their tendency to react energetically without external oxidizers.
